Here's a little study that might prove helpful....

CONVICTION THAT LEADS TO REPENTANCE
by Terry Somerville

John 16:8 And when he comes, he will convince (convict) the world concerning sin and righteousness and judgment:

One of the true signs of the Holy Spirit at work is the conviction of sin. Gifts of the Holy Spirit are a teaching of Paul, but Holy Spirit conviction of sin is a teaching of Jesus. We need it in the church! Could it be that we see so little conviction of sin in our ministries because we need this work of God applied to our self?


What is The Conviction of The Holy Spirit?

The conviction of the Holy Spirit is a work of God in the heart. It is not a mere ‘understanding” that we have sinned. It is the heart wrenching revelation of God concerning our true condition. What is it like?

THE CONVICTION OF SIN, says deep inside " I am guilty of that sin!” It is personal, particular and inescapable. While it is specific about sins, it is usually all encompassing as well - involving the whole state of my heart, and why those sins were allowed. Unless the Spirit is grieved away, it will press on the mind and heart until something must be done. The sin will weary us with distress over our guilt and duplicity of heart.

THE CONVICTION OF RIGHTEOUSNESS is deeply knowing what righteousness requires in my situation and that I am not righteous! For instance, I may be convicted of speaking ill of another. I am absolutely certain of what I have done, I know the cruel words I spoke, and furthermore, I know the loving righteous words I should have said. I clearly see what God demands in my innermost being concerning righteousness, and my sin.

THE CONVICTION OF JUDGMENT is the Holy Spirit establishing that I should be condemned and I have no means of escape. I see I am plainly guilty and worthy of condemnation. Jesus said the “prince of this world is judged”. The author of sin is removed, there is no barrier any longer.


CONVICTION
+
REPENTANCE
=
RESTORATION


The ultimate outcome is a great breaking down of the ‘fountains of sin” in the heart. We must ‘break up the fallow ground” of our heart and agree with God against ourself! The selfish life must be brought down for the life Christ to reign!

Conviction is not pleasant and the wicked heart of man has many escape plans! Sometimes we want to relieve the distress, but the wise pastor will not coddle those under conviction. He will force the work to go deeper. The only true remedy is repentance and a life of righteous living by faith! Learn to recognize the signs of avoiding conviction of sin and don't grieve the Spirit by giving in to them!

Guard Your "Eye Gate"
by Jill Austin
www.masterpotter.com
Excerpts taken from
Dancing With Destiny: Awaken your Heart to Dream, to Love, to War




We cannot take the Holy Spirit for granted and assume that He will move through dirty vessels.
Many times we think we get away with watching sex, violence and profanity on TV or at the movies, but the Holy Spirit is right there with us telling us He is being offended. We are not filled with the Holy Spirit only when we witness to the lost; we are modern-day Arks of the Covenant wherever we go, all the time.

A number of years ago when our ministry team was in the Midwest, a couple took one of my actresses named Naomi and me to a movie. After five minutes, I began to "see" something in the Spirit: Demons were coming out of the screen and filling the theater. I realized that I should leave, but I was looking forward to a relaxing time, since it was my first night out after holding meetings all week. Besides, wouldn't it offend our hosts?

I was wrestling with all of this because the Lord kept telling me to leave. He told me that I would be ministering to His people the next day, and He wanted me to be clean. He did not want me to watch that movie.

I had no recourse. It was not okay for me to get slimy at the show when He had told me to leave. I could not become covered with all kinds of filth, and then say, "Forgive me, God. Amen." I would not have been a fit vessel for Jesus in the meetings if I had stayed.

I leaned over to Naomi and said, "Do you see anything coming out of the screen?"

She said, "Oh, no, Jill. You mean we have to leave?"

I whispered that we would be in trouble if we stayed. We both knew it would not be worth it.

I explained to our hosts that the Lord was not allowing us to sit through the movie since there was sex and violence going on. They said, "Well, we have paid our money. If you want to wait in the lobby, that's fine."

Naomi and I plopped on benches in the lobby for the next hour and a half. The best part was that God moved powerfully the next day in both of the services. I knew in my heart that I was clean before the Lord and obedient to what He wanted.

Because I am an artist and I was born and raised in Hollywood, movies have been a way for me to relax and have fun; there are great films out there, and I have a real passion for the movie industry. But the content of many has become perverted, violent and subtly laced with the occult.

We fight many battles in spiritual warfare, and one of the most powerful weapons of the enemy against us is his ability to pollute our minds through the "eye gate." The more evil that passes through our eyes into our hearts and minds, the more clouded our vision becomes and the less we are able to see in the realm of the Spirit.

This infiltration has increased in every aspect of the electronic age-television, movies, the Internet, radio, computer and video games, cartoons. The written word-magazines, books, newspapers, ads, comic books-is also affected. We are, in fact, bombarded by destructive visual images. The danger is that we become culturally desensitized; those images begin to seem normal because they are so familiar. The line between biblical truth and cultural acceptance becomes fuzzy after a while.

Think about it: Are you asking the Lord to help you see in the Spirit realm, but then going to a movie where all kinds of perversion are displayed? Maybe you are attending a meeting where the presence and power of God is moving and you are learning to hear His voice; your child is sitting next to you reading a Harry Potter book, beguiling stories from the second heaven-the satanic realms. Both are supernatural gates.

The enemy has anesthetized us, and we do not even recognize the compromise in our own lives. We need discernment and wisdom desperately. We must be watchful and let the Holy Spirit speak to us about what to do and what not to do. In addition, it is important that we humble ourselves and repent where we have sinned. Before you have the authority to bring freedom to others, you must deal with those sins in your own life.
